Performance

The TCL 605’s Mediatek Helio G81, featuring a combination of 2x2.0 GHz Cortex-A75 and 6x1.8 GHz Cortex-A55 cores, offers a more robust CPU architecture than the OnePlus Nord N20 SE’s Helio G35. The G35’s 4x2.3 GHz Cortex-A53 and 4x1.8 GHz Cortex-A53 configuration, while clocked slightly higher, relies on less efficient core designs. This translates to a noticeable performance advantage for the TCL 605 in multi-tasking and demanding applications. The G81’s architecture is better suited for sustained workloads, meaning less throttling during extended gaming sessions. While neither chipset is a powerhouse, the TCL 605 provides a smoother, more responsive experience.

❓ Will the Mediatek Helio G81 in the TCL 605 handle demanding games like PUBG or Call of Duty Mobile?
The Helio G81 can run PUBG and Call of Duty Mobile, but you’ll likely need to lower the graphics settings to medium or low to maintain a stable frame rate. The G81’s architecture is better suited for sustained gaming than the G35, meaning less throttling over longer sessions. Don't expect flagship-level performance, but it's perfectly playable for casual gaming.
